Project Governance Manager

Role Overview

We are looking for an experienced Project Governance Manager to join a leading bank in Saudi Arabia. The role will be responsible for establishing and overseeing project governance frameworks to ensure effective delivery of strategic and regulatory initiatives. The ideal candidate will bring ex–Big 4 consulting experience and strong exposure to banking environments, with the ability to work within Saudi regulatory and compliance stand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Establish, implement, and maintain project governance frameworks, standards, and controls across banking programs and initiatives
  • Ensure compliance with Saudi banking regulations, internal policies, and governance requirements
  • Provide oversight and assurance across project and transformation portfolios, including progress tracking, risk and issue management, and escalation
  • Prepare governance dashboards, reports, and materials for senior management and steering committees
  • Review project documentation (business cases, plans, delivery artifacts) to ensure quality and compliance
  • Work closely with business, IT, risk, compliance, and internal audit teams
  • Support regulatory and audit engagements where required
  • Drive consistency and best practices in project delivery across the bank

Requirements

Required Experience & Skills

  • 8–12+ years of experience in project governance, PMO, or transformation roles
  • Previous Big 4 consulting experience (Deloitte, PwC, EY, KPMG) is highly preferred
  • Proven experience working in banks or financial services organizations
  • Strong understanding of banking regulations and governance frameworks applicable in Saudi Arabia
  • Experience with large-scale transformation, regulatory, or strategic programs
  • Strong stakeholder management and communication skills
  • Ability to operate confidently with senior leadership
